How to Properly Care for Your Solid Oven Mitts

Taking proper care of your solid oven mitts is essential to maintain their heat protection properties and extend their lifespan. Most oven mitts are machine washable, but it’s always best to check the manufacturer’s instructions. If they are machine washable, a gentle cycle with mild detergent is typically recommended, and air drying is often best to prevent any potential damage from high heat in the dryer.

If your mitts are stained or soiled, pre-treating the stains with a bit of dish soap or a specialized stain remover can do wonders. Simply apply the treatment to the stained area and let it sit for about 15 minutes before washing. This ensures that your mitts stay looking fresh, and it also helps in removing any odors that might develop over time, especially if you’re a frequent baker or cook.

Moreover, it’s important to store your oven mitts properly. Hanging them near your oven not only makes them easily accessible but also allows them to air out after washing, preventing mildew. Common Mistakes to Avoid When Using Oven Mitts

Even with a sturdy pair of oven mitts, there are common pitfalls that cooks often fall into. One frequent mistake is using them when they are wet or damp. Water can conduct heat, which means if your mitts are wet, you might risk burning your hands when handling hot pots or trays. Always make sure your mitts are dry before grabbing anything from the oven or stovetop to avoid painful burns.

Another common issue is using the mitts for tasks they aren’t designed for. Some people might think it’s a good idea to use oven mitts to handle sharp objects or as trivets under hot dishes, but that can lead to both burns and cuts. Designate your mitts strictly for hot items, and rely on different tools for other cooking tasks. This not only keeps you safe but also helps keep your mitts in great condition for longer.

Finally, forgetting to regularly inspect your oven mitts is a mistake too. Over time, wear and tear can compromise their heat resistance. Always check for any wear, such as fraying seams or thinning fabric. If they start to show signs of damage, it’s definitely time to replace them, as continuing to use damaged mitts can lead to accidents. Regular maintenance ensures that your cooking experience remains safe and enjoyable.

1. Material Matters

When selecting the best solid oven mitts, the material is one of the first factors to consider. You’ll commonly find mitts made from cotton, silicone, or a combination of both. Cotton oven mitts are soft and comfortable to wear, but they may not offer the best heat resistance. Silicone mitts, on the other hand, are known for their superior heat protection and excellent grip.

Think about what you’ll be using the oven mitts for. If you’re an avid baker, silicone might be the way to go for handling those hot cookie sheets. If you’re just starting out in the kitchen and enjoy the feel of a cotton mitt, there are plenty of great options that offer a balance of comfort and protection.

2. Heat Resistance

Heat resistance is crucial when looking for the best solid oven mitts. Not all mitts are created equal in this department. Some can only withstand temperatures up to a certain limit, while others can handle temperatures well over 500°F. If you’re someone who loves using cast iron skillets or pulling dishes straight from the oven, you’ll want to invest in oven mitts with high heat resistance.

It’s important to check the specifications before buying. Imagine pulling out a piping hot lasagna and getting burned because your mitts couldn’t handle the heat! Always look for the temperature rating to ensure you’re fully protected while cooking.

3. Length and Coverage

The length of your oven mitts can make a world of difference in how protected you feel when removing hot dishes. Shorter mitts may leave your wrists and forearms exposed, and burns can happen in the blink of an eye. Longer mitts, often reaching a length of 13 inches or more, provide additional coverage, reducing the risk of burns.

If you frequently use a stove or oven that has deeper cavities, longer mitts can give you that extra peace of mind. Plus, they can help prevent pesky spills that can occur from drooping mitts. Think about your kitchen habits when deciding on the right length for you.

Are silicone oven mitts better than cotton ones?

Silicone oven mitts and cotton oven mitts each have unique advantages. Silicone mitts tend to excel in providing excellent grip and flexibility, making them great for handling hot pots or pans. They are also waterproof, which means spills won’t soak through them. However, they can be less insulated than thicker cotton mitts, so if you’re specifically dealing with very hot items for extended periods, you might want to consider a cotton option for more protection.

On the other hand, cotton mitts often provide a cozy feel and excellent insulation. While they might not offer the same level of grip as silicone, they’re great if you need to pull something hot out of the oven quickly. Plus, cotton mitts often come in a variety of designs and colors, allowing you to express your personal style in the kitchen! Ultimately, the choice depends on how you plan to use them.

What is the difference between mitts and gloves?

The key difference between mitts and gloves lies in their design. Oven mitts typically have a single compartment for all fingers, allowing for a bit more flexibility when grabbing large or awkward items. They often provide better insulation and protection for your forearms, making them ideal for handling hot dishes straight from the oven. This broader coverage can be particularly beneficial when you’re reaching into a hot oven or grill.

On the other hand, oven gloves usually feature individual finger compartments, which can offer more dexterity for gripping smaller items like pans or baking sheets. If you find yourself often handling multiple small items at once or need detailed control over your movements, gloves may be the better option. Choosing between them really depends on your cooking style and personal preferences!
